| Description: | Our Gene-specific Break Apart Probes usually target the flanks of the target gene (RNF2). Due to this design method, our probe products can detect chromosomal rearrangements, such as translocations, by FISH.The product usually consists of a reagent combination composed of a probe with a selected dye color and a hybridization reagent. |
| Application: | RNF2 Gene-specific Break Apart Probe is designed to detect potential RNF2 rearrangements. This probe has been confirmed on the metaphase and interphase chromosomes by FISH. | Gene Name | Ring Finger Protein 2 |
| Gene Summary [Provided by RefSeq] | Polycomb group (PcG) of proteins form the multiprotein complexes that are important for the transcription repression of various genes involved in development and cell proliferation. The protein encoded by this gene is one of the PcG proteins. It has been shown to interact with, and suppress the activity of, transcription factor CP2 (TFCP2/CP2). Studies of the mouse counterpart suggested the involvement of this gene in the specification of anterior-posterior axis, as well as in cell proliferation in early development. This protein was also found to interact with huntingtin interacting protein 2 (HIP2), an ubiquitin-conjugating enzyme, and possess ubiquitin ligase activity.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008] |
